Beautiful mountain home on the golf course, nestled in Arizona's cool mountain town, Payson! The home is a beautifully-appointed, fully-furnished 1-story ranch with south-facing deck and outdoor barbeques. Secluded down a private, tree-lined driveway at the edge of Country Club Estates, it's a quiet place. Free of traffic noise, you can hear the sounds of hummingbirds and wildlife... and golfers out on the fairway!

Payson's weather is absolutely unbeatable! Comfortable dry climate, with warm days and cool nights (NOT like Phoenix!) 89 /59 summer... 56 /26 winter. "Hazy-hot-n-humid" doesn't exist here, and there are no relentless winters. Deep blue skies... 286 annual days of sunshine... and dark, starry nights. Due to Payson's strict light pollution controls, you can enjoy the nighttime Milky Way right from the deck!

Home has 2 bedrooms (or 3 including the office with sofabed). 2 full bathrooms plus a men's lavatory in garage. 3-car garage. Built in 1994. See floorplan on the website, www -dot- paysonhomerental -dot- com.
